House Bill No. 7284, also known as Special Act No. 25-14, authorizes the Commissioner of Administrative Services to convey a parcel of state land, approximately 1.98 acres in size and identified as Lot 20 in Block 23 of the Preston Tax Assessor's Map, to the town of Preston. This land, located at 20 Route 117 and previously part of the Norwich State Hospital, will be transferred at a cost that covers only the administrative expenses associated with the conveyance. The transfer is contingent upon approval from the State Properties Review Board, which must complete its review within thirty days of receiving the proposed agreement from the Department of Administrative Services.
The town of Preston is required to utilize the land and any improvements for designated purposes such as open space, recreational activities, or farmers' market functions. If the town fails to use the land for these purposes, does not maintain ownership, or leases any part of the property, the land will revert back to the state of Connecticut. The bill also stipulates that the State Treasurer will execute any necessary deeds or instruments for the conveyance, which must include provisions to ensure compliance with the intended use of the property as outlined in the bill.
